rxb-I'm surprised there was neither JSW NOR Manic Miner on this "inspired by the "real Retro" featyre from Charlie Brooker's Gameswipe from BBC the other night!

Practically all of this can be pulled back to that TV show and that's no bsad thing when you think of the clever way around lack of 3D Sentinel managed at that time.

Old British C64 and Speccy games are the muts nuts for me as far as retro goes even IF Jet Set Willy was broken in two places and you needed to glitch it twice(and know where to do it too) just to get to halfway through the damn game(just after The Banyan Tree level IIRC-could be wrong it's long time since I allowed this game to ruin my mood!). But even if it was criminally broken it was still hyper mad and imaginative and deserved a place here as a game some more folk would have played.

Even the old £1.99 C64 games could be good AND mad. I remember a rip off version of Paperpboy crossed with NMX bandits type thing which wasincane and you got points for avioding city gents and grannies who would stick unbrellas and walking sticks into your spokes respectively.

You could always rely on a mental celevration screen wit cool 8bit music too when you beat a game-usually with crap pretend fireworks too!
